How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 81611?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 81611 1 Bedroom Apartments | $16,416 | $9,582 | $23,250 |
| 81611 2 Bedroom Apartments | $21,769 | $6,000 | $30,000 |
| 81611 3 Bedroom Apartments | $23,630 | $19,522 | $30,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 81611 ZIP Code
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 81611 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 81611 range from $6,000 to $30,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$21,769.
How expensive are 81611 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 3 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 81611 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$19,522 to $30,000 - averaging $23,630 for the location.
